Allow garbage collection of revealed file ports.
Reported at <https://bugs.gnu.org/28784>. Discussed at <https://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/guile-devel/2017-10/msg00003.html>. * libguile/fports.c (revealed_ports, revealed_lock): Remove. (scm_revealed_count): Just return 'SCM_REVEALED (port)'. (scm_set_port_revealed_x, scm_adjust_port_revealed_x): Remove REVEALED_PORTS manipulation. (fport_close): Do nothing when SCM_REVEALED (port) > 0. * libguile/fports.h (scm_t_fport): Adjust comment; make 'revealed' unsigned. * libguile/ports.c (do_close): Call 'close_port' instead of 'scm_close_port'. (scm_close_port): Rename to... (close_port): ... this. Add 'explicit' parameter. Clear 'revealed' field when PORT is a file port and EXPLICIT is true. (scm_close_port): Call 'close_port'. * test-suite/tests/ports.test ("close-port & revealed port") ("revealed port fdes not closed"): New tests.
